President Japarov of Kyrgyzstan presented Turkish President Erdoğan with the highest order of the republic. According to RIA Novosti, President Sadyr Japarov of Kyrgyzstan presented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an the Manas Order of the First Degree, the highest order of the republic. The order was awarded at a meeting of leaders in the new building of the Presidential Administration, "Bintymak Ordo" in Bishkek. This order was awarded for President Erdoğan's great contribution to deepening the relations between Kyrgyzstan and Türkiye, Japarov stated. The Manas Order of the First Degree is the highest order in Kyrgyzstan....

The President of the Republic of Türkiye met with the Prime Minister of Iraq and discussed the situation in the Middle East. President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an and Prime Minister Mohammed Shia Al Sudani of Iraq held a meeting in Istanbul. President Erdoğan of Türkiye addressed the significant security threats that terrorist organisations pose to both Türkiye and Iraq, called for an integrated strategy to tackle these threats, and emphasised the necessity of peace and stability.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an on Tuesday vowed to continue eliminating terrorist threats at their source. "Whether it is within our borders or beyond, no one can prevent us from eliminating any threat we detect against our country," Erdogan said at a ceremony for the delivery of the T625 Gokbey helicopter to the gendarmerie. The handover ceremony was held at the headquarters of Turkish Aerospace Industries (TUSAS) in the Kahramankazan district of Ankara, where two assailants carried out a terror attack last week, leaving five people dead and 22 others wounded. Türkiye’s state-owned energy company TPAO and Somalia's petroleum authority signed a deal on joint onshore hydrocarbon exploration in Somalia, Turkish Energy Minister Alparslan Bayraktar said on Friday. "With this agreement, we will carry out oil and gas research operations on Somali land fields," he said without providing details. Earlier this year, Türkiye and Somalia signed a defence and economic cooperation agreement during a visit to Ankara by the Somali defence minister. Türkiye showcases its strength at defence exhibition with “Bayraktar TB3” and “Maritime Fighter UAV”
The Türkiye Defence and Aerospace Exhibition is taking place in İstanbul from October 22 to 26. This year's exhibition highlights Türkiye's latest unmanned combat aerial vehicle, the "Bayraktar TB3", alongside the TALAY UAV, designed specifically for naval warfare. Unveiled at the exhibition, the Bayraktar TB3 emerges as a significant enhancement over its predecessor, the TB2. With its impressive ability to land on and take off from aircraft carriers, the TB3 also possesses the capability for autonomous flight and precision assault missions.
